锦瑞煤业9101工作面沿空留巷关键技术研究

    Research on key technology of staying along the hollow of 9101 working face in Jinrui Coal Industry

    • 摘要: 为缓解采掘衔接紧张,减少资源浪费,实现沿空留巷,以锦瑞煤业9101工作面为背景,采用数值模拟及现场围岩位移监测等方法,确定了切顶留巷的合理参数为,切顶角度5°,切顶高度6.5 m,并设计补强支护方案。现场监测表明,留巷围岩变形量均在可控范围内,可继续为下个工作面服务。

       

      Abstract: To relieve the tension of mining and excavation, reduce the waste of resources, and realise leaving the lane along the empty space, taking 9101 working face of Jinrui Coal Industry as the background, numerical simulation and on-site peripheral rock displacement monitoring and other methods are used to determine the reasonable parameters of cutting the top and leaving the lane as follows: the angle of cutting the top is 5°, the height of the top cutting is 6.5 m, and the reinforcing support scheme is designed. On-site monitoring shows that the deformation of the surrounding rock in the left-lane is within the controllable range, and it can continue to serve for the next working face.
